Author: Wilson, Douglas, edited and with several selections by, Title: Passages of Time: narratives in the history of Amherst College.
Description: np, Amherst College Press, (2007). VG in VG DJ. Editor Wilson worked for 27 years in the publications office of Amherst, retiring in 2002. Most of the selections in this. anthology are narrative chapters of Amherst history from earliest days to recent time. They take the reader chronologically from the 1820s when students learned the rudiments of "Vulgar Arithmetic" up to a 1990 colloquium on quantum mechanics. Student anti-slavery efforts, Civil War casualties, college dealing with landscape architect Frederick Law Olmsted, baseball glories, faculty deliberations, and a black student's sensitive view of his undergraduate experience in the 1970s. Each sectopm is opened with the editor's short introduction.
